Residential Waterproofing in Tuscaloosa, AL
Residential waterproofing services focus on protecting homes from water intrusion and damage. These services typically include sealing foundations, installing waterproof barriers, applying damp-proofing coatings, and addressing drainage issues around the property. Projects often involve basement and crawl space waterproofing, exterior wall sealing, and improving gutter and drainage systems to prevent water buildup. Homeowners usually seek information about the best methods for their specific property, potential signs of water problems, and how waterproofing can help maintain the structural integrity and value of their home.
Before requesting waterproofing services, property owners should understand the extent of existing water issues, such as leaks, mold, or foundation cracks. It’s important to consider the condition of the home's exterior and basement or crawl space areas, as these are common sites needing attention. Clarifying the scope of work, including whether interior or exterior solutions are appropriate, can ensure the project effectively addresses water concerns and provides long-term protection for the home.

Common Residential Waterproofing Jobs
Basement Waterproofing - prevents water intrusion and protects foundation integrity.
Foundation Sealing - stops water from seeping through foundation walls and floors.
Exterior Drainage Systems - directs water away from the property to reduce basement flooding.
Crawl Space Waterproofing - keeps crawl spaces dry and prevents mold growth.
Wall Waterproofing - safeguards interior walls from moisture damage and staining.
Leak Repair - addresses existing leaks to maintain a dry and stable home environment.
Residential Waterproofing Questions
What is residential waterproofing? Residential waterproofing involves sealing and protecting a home's foundation and basement from water intrusion and moisture damage.
Which areas of a home benefit from waterproofing? Common areas include basements, crawl spaces, foundations, and exterior walls prone to water exposure.
What types of waterproofing methods are available? Methods include interior sealants, exterior drainage systems, sump pumps, and membrane applications to prevent water penetration.
Why is waterproofing important for homeowners? Proper waterproofing helps prevent structural damage, mold growth, and moisture-related issues that can affect health and property value.
